Paysign experienced a notable revenue decline of over 30% between 2019 and 2020, yet has since delivered a remarkable operating income increase exceeding 600% from 2024 to 2025. This turnaround is underpinned by its vertically integrated prepaid card lifecycle platform, diversified product offerings across corporate, government, and niche pharmaceutical markets, and focused investments in scalable technology. While the pharma patient affordability segment drives growth opportunities, it also introduces regulatory and concentration risks that require close monitoring. Free cash flow generation improved substantially in 2025, supporting modest share repurchases and reflecting disciplined capital allocation amid competitive pressure.
